INTRODUCTION
This employee is responsible for responding to, as well as initiating incoming and outgoing potential customer inquiries, while using company resources, policies, and procedures to provide complete, accurate data.
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Responsible for sales to hospitals, oncology, rehabilitation centers, and other referral sources with enteral patient needs, and for all aspects of enteral nutrition care for the home tube fed patient and other medical nutrition related activities
- Uses appropriate technologies and follow processes in accordance with company standards to ensure patient and physician contact is handled with accuracy and operational effectiveness
JOB FUNCTIONS
- Identifies and develops new referral sources
- Responsible for obtaining a predetermined number of enteral setups from new referral sources each month
- Establishes referral source and customer contact by initiating follow-up outbound calls and receiving inbound return calls
- Promotes products and facilitates referral source needs to utilize company's products or services by adequately assessing referral source qualification, thoroughly explaining product/services benefits, and assisting with facilitating physician communication as necessary
- Stays up to date on current formulary
- Conducts in-service for referral sources, educating them in the use and application of enteral equipment
- Recognizes and respects patient rights during the provision of care or services and conduct business relationships with patients and the public in an ethical manner
- Responsible for a designated territory performing sales activities, tracking daily sales activity, promoting enteral services to physicians, hospitals, home health, and cancer centers, as well as maintaining market information in sales tracking platform
- Contributes to departmental objectives by accomplishing required contact and sales results, with ability to track and report progress of sales results
- Facilitates sales process by communicating/sharing information with appropriate internal and external contacts
- Records customer information and maintains database by obtaining, entering, and verifying required data
- Provides customer follow-up as required
- Educates patients in relation to their enteral feeding to facilitate safe and effective use and desired care, treatment, and service outcomes
- Responsible for maintaining and managing a minimum monthly patient admits/census
- Promotes safe, effective patient and organizational environments and feeding equipment use
- Obtains, utilizes, and updates patient information in a confidential and secure manner for utilization in patient care applications
- Coordinates delivery and pickup of such items as enteral formula, feeding pump(s), IV poles, related feeding supplies to patients' homes or places of business
- Listens to and resolves service complaints appropriate to scope of practice
- Issues sales promotion materials to customers
- Issues or obtains customer signature on admission, pickup, or delivery
- Monitors patients' responses to the care or services provided, the actions or interventions taken, and the outcome of the care or service provided
- Participates in on-going education, including in-services, training, and other activities, to maintain and improve individual competence
- Provides enteral nutrition recommendations to providers based on clinical evaluation
- Stays up to date on current enteral nutrition practice guidelines
- Analyzes nutritionally comparable formulas
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
Education
- Bachelor's Degree Dietetics or Nutrition from an accredited institution, Required
- Registered Dietitian from the Commission on Dietetic Registration
Work Experience
- One year in home healthcare, hospital, clinic, or nursing home, Preferred
- Dietetics, Nutrition, Home Health, or Nursing, Preferred
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
- Read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operating and ma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als
- Calculate figures and amounts such as commissions, proportions, percentages, area, circumference, and volume
- Solve practical probl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ists
- Interpret a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form
- Word processing, spreadsheets, and e-mail communications
- Must have excellent communication
- English-oral and written
- Medical industry beneficial
- Type at least 25-30 words per minute
Licenses and Certifications
- Licensed as a Dietitian for geographic areas where employee manages patients

Ask about LCA timing during offer negotiations
Your employer must file a certified Labor Condition Application with the DOL before USCIS can adjudicate an H-1B petition. Ask the recruiter which step in their onboarding process initiates the LCA filing so you can plan your start date without gaps in work authorization.
Leverage OPT or TN status for an early start
If you're on F-1 OPT or qualify for TN status, you may be able to begin employment while an H-1B petition is pending. Confirm with Lincare's HR team whether they'll initiate sponsorship concurrent with your current authorization to avoid a break in employment.

How do I plan my timeline if Lincare offers H-1B sponsorship?
Cap-subject H-1B petitions can only be filed once per year, with USCIS accepting registrations in March for an October 1 start date. If you receive an offer outside that window, you may need to bridge the gap using OPT, CPT, or TN status while the petition is pending. Confirming the filing timeline with Lincare's HR or legal team immediately after receiving an offer lets you plan your work authorization without an unplanned gap.
